Rio's Bodega Spania serves Spanish fare to World Cup final fans
Bodega Spania, a Spanish‑themed restaurant in the Anchieta neighborhood of Rio de Janeiro, will open its doors on Sunday, July 19, to welcome supporters of the Spanish national team for the World Cup final against Argentina. The venue will feature live cooking of traditional paella, a menu that blends Spanish dishes such as Pulpo a la Gallega, Calamares Empanados, Gambas al Ajillo and sangria with Brazilian favorites like feijoada and churrasco, and a special program that includes big‑screen broadcasts of the match and a flamenco dance performance.
